Tony and guest host Hanlon Walsh debate the pros and cons of the US Open’s mixed doubles format. Hanlon is a former collegiate tennis player and writes about pro doubles for The Tennis Tribe. Tony is an annoying gay with a microphone. So it works perfectly. 


Read Hanlon’s (thorough as hell!) US Open Mixed Doubles Preview, and don’t miss his LGBTQ+ Tennis Roundtable featuring prominent community members in tennis. 


Here’s what you can expect from this episode: 


  • Hanlon talks about his collegiate tennis experience as a member of the LGBTQ+ community
  • Tony explains why he likes the new scoring system for mixed doubles at the US Open (controversial, I know) 
  • They discuss how the draw is made for this year's tournament
  • Plus, find out which players Tony and Hanlon see themselves as
